Output 08589edceeb583856992d126df68289c4bd21428ed0a1ac18f9e5ece4deef6d3:29
- value
- 953384
- script pubkey
- OP_0 OP_PUSHBYTES_20 f16231c32e7835df7b640e5b7e5e0762e0f54388
- address
- bc1q793rrsew0q6a77mypedhuhs8vts02sugjlr8pm
- transaction
- 08589edceeb583856992d126df68289c4bd21428ed0a1ac18f9e5ece4deef6d3
- spent
- true